本书以人力资源管理系统案例开发与管理为主线,深入浅出地介绍Oracle 11g数据库系统开发与管理的基础知识。全书包括4个组成部分。*部分介绍Oracle数据库系统的构建,包括数据库服务器的安装与配置、数据库常用管理与开发工具介绍、数据库体系结构介绍等;第二部分介绍人力资源管理系统数据库开发,包括数据库的创建、数据库存储结构设置、数据库对象的创建与应用、利用SQL语句与数据库交互、利用PL/SQL进行数据库功能模块开发等;第三部分介绍Oracle数据库的管理与维护,包括数据库启动与关闭、安全性管理、备份与恢复管理、数据库闪回管理、初始化参数文件管理等;第四部分介绍基于Oracle数据库的应用开发,包括人力资源管理应用开发、图书管理系统设计与开发和餐饮评价系统设计与开发等。附录A为实验部分,提供8个实验,供学生实践、练习。 本书
本书以Oracle 12c(中文版)作为平台,分别介绍Oracle数据库管理系统和在当前流行平台上开发Oracle数据库应用系统。Oracle数据库管理系统介绍Oracle 12c的主要功能,语法为中文层次格式,实例数据库表字段名为汉字,方便教学。流行平台包括PHP 5、Java EE 7和Visual C# 2013。综合应用实习数据准备通过创建实习用数据库及其对象,简单小结Oracle数据库的基本对象创建和操作,不同平台操作同样的数据库,实现同样功能,给读者带来了极大的方便。 本书可作为大学本科、高职高专有关课程教材,也可供广大Oracle数据库应用开发人员使用或参考。
针对数据库的启动和关闭、控制文件与数据库初始化、参数及参数文件、数据字典、内存管理、Buffer Cache与Shared Pool原理、重做、回滚与撤销、等待事件、性能诊断与SQL优化等几大Oracle热点主题,本书从基础知识入手,深入研究相关技术,并结合性能调整及丰富的诊断案例,力图将Oracle知识全面、系统、深入地展现给读者。 本书给出了大量取自实际工作现场的实例,在分析实例的过程中,兼顾深度与广度,不仅对实际问题的现象、产生原因和相关的原理进行了深入浅出的讲解,更主要的是,结合实际应用环境,提供了一系列解决问题的思路和方法,包括详细的操作步骤,具有很强的实战性和可操作性,适用于具备一定数据库基础、打算深入学习Oracle技术的数据库从业人员,尤其适用于入门、进阶以及希望深入研究Oracle技术的数据库管理人员。
Oracle是一个庞大的系统,包含大量技术、选项和版本。大多数用户——包括富有经验的开发者和数据库管理员——都会发现完全掌握Oracle数据库是非常困难的。同时,随着每个Oracle版本的发布,用户发现自己始终面临不断学习新技术的压力,目前*的挑战是Orcale数据库11g。 本书从Oracle数据库的大量信息中提炼关键内容,按照易于阅读和紧凑的方式进行组织,同时配以说明文字、图形和有价值的提示信息。本书包含如下内容: ·Oracle产品、选项、数据结构、Oracle数据库11g的整体架构以及早期版本(Oracle数据库10g、Oracle数据库9i和Oracle数据库8i)的简单说明。 ·如何安装、运行、管理、监控、联网和调整Oracle——包括企业管理器(EM)以及Oracle自我调整和管理能力——以及如何使用Oracle安全、审计和依从性(本版中新增的——章内容)。 ·多用户并发、
三位经验丰富的*Oracle DBA再次联手,为读者呈现这本Oracle数据库性能优化攻略。《Oracle Database 11g性能优化攻略》由表及里地深入分析了造成Oracle数据库性能缓慢的各种原因,然后给出标本兼治的性能调优方案。作者将多年的实践经验和个人智慧与读者分享,帮助读者诊治影响数据库性能的各种疑难杂症。 《Oracle Database 11g性能优化攻略》可帮助数据库管理员解决各种Oracle数据库性能问题。
本书用简单易懂的实例和大量的图示,深入浅出地介绍了Oracle数据库的操作与编程方面的知识。作者以实际工作为切入点,详细介绍了Oracle数据库的基础知识及PL/SQL程序设计实战的知识。本书共分为17章,主要介绍了数据库的入门知识、安装Oracle以及使用Oracle的客户端工具管理Oracle,Oracle数据库表、索引、约束、视图、序列和同义词的创建与使用方法,如何使用DML语句和SELECT语句查询与管理数据库对象,PL/SQL编程方面的知识,以及用户与数据库表空间的管理。
本书紧密围绕编程人员在编程中遇到的实际问题和开发中应该掌握的技术,全面介绍了使用Oracle进行程序开发的各方面技术和技巧。全书分为20章,内容包括Oracle数据库基础,SQL Plus命令行工具的使用,表及表空间基本操作,PL/SQL流程控制,基础查询,函数在查询中的应用,高级查询,索引与视图,存储过程与事务处理,触发器,游标,控制文件和日志文件的使用,分区技术,用户、角色与权限控制,Oracle性能优化,数据的备份与恢复,数据的导出和导入,闪回技术的应用,Oracle在Java开发中的应用和Oracle在VC++开发中的应用。全书共提供了460个实例,每个实例都突出了实用性,其中大部分是程序开发者梦寐以求的疑难问题的解决方案。 本书附有配套光盘。光盘提供了书中所有实例的源代码,全部源代码都经过调试,在Windows XP/Windows Server 2003/Windows 7下测试通
在《让Oracle跑得更快:Oracle10g性能分析与优化思路》里读者将会学到作者在性能优化方面的一些思路和思考,一些故障处理的方法和原则,这些东西是作者在实践中长期积累的心得体会,当读者掌握了一些处理问题的基本思路之后,成为一名合格的DBA就是一件轻而易举的事情了。 《让Oracle跑得更快:Oracle 10g性能分析与优化思路》适用对象:OracleDBA、Oracle开发人员,和其他对Oracle数据库感兴趣的人员。
在《让Oracle跑得更快:Oracle 10g性能分析与优化思路》里读者将会学到作者在性能优化方面的一些思路和思考,一些故障处理的方法和原则,这些东西是作者在实践中长期积累的心得体会,当读者掌握了一些处理问题的基本思路之后,成为一名合格的DBA就是一件轻而易举的事情了。 《让Oracle跑得更快:Oracle 10g性能分析与优化思路》适用对象:Oracle DBA、Oracle开发人员,和其他对Oracle数据库感兴趣的人员。
《Oracle数据库管理从入门到精通》 《Oracle数据库管理从入门到精通(附光盘)》以 面向应用为原则,深入浅出地介绍了Oracle数据库的 管理和开发技术。书中通过大量的图解和示例代码, 详细介绍了Oracle的体系结构、PL/SQL的语言特性, 并深入剖析了用PL/SQL进行Oracle开发的方方面面。 为了便于读者高效、直观地学习,作者为本书重点内 容录制了13.6小时多媒体教学视频。这些视频及本书 涉及的源代码一起收录于本书配套DVD光盘中。另外 ,光盘中还免费赠送了7.8小时Oracle PL/SQL教学视 频和大量的PL/SQL实例代码,供读者进一步学习参考 。 《Oracle数据库管理从入门到精通(附光盘)》 共24章,分为6篇。涵盖的内容主要有关系 型数据库基础、Oracle的安装和管理、体系结构、网 络结构、物理和逻辑结构的维护和管理、SQL语言的 应用、PL/SQL语言基础、开发环境、控制语句、数
《Oracle PL/SQL程序设计(第5版)》基于Oracle数据库11g,从PL/SQL编程、PL/SQL程序结构、PL/SQL程序数据、PL/SQL中的SQL、PL/SQL应用构建、高级PL/SQL主题这6个方面详细系统地讨论了PL/SQL以及如何有效地使用它。本书能够帮助你充分利用PL/SQL来解决数据库开发中遇到的各种问题,引导你掌握各种构建应用的技巧和技术,以便使你编写出高效、可维护的代码。《Oracle PL/SQL程序设计(第5版)》不但介绍了大量的Oracle 11g的PL/SQL新性能,还提供了许多优化PL/SQL性能的新方法。 《Oracle PL/SQL程序设计(第5版)》结构清晰,示例丰富,实践性强,适用于Oracle数据库开发人员、Oracle数据库管理员等相关数据库从业人员,也可以作为各大、中专院校相关专业师生的参考用书和相关培训机构的培训教材。
Oracle 数据库的应用十分广泛,数据库性能的好坏直接影响应用程序能否快速响应用户指令。而 Oracle 数据库又比较复杂,数据库性能调优成为众多 DBA 为头疼的问题。 本书作者凭借其 20 多年的丰富经验,为我们带来了一本系统的、全面的 Oracle 性能优化手册,用结构化方法帮助读者解决从数据库应用到数据库设计的所有问题。全书分为 6 部分、 23 章,实例丰富,兼具技术深度和广度,被读者誉为 “ 有用的 Oracle 性能调优参考书 ” 。主要内容包括: 有效的 Oracle 性能优化方法描述; 如何充分利用 Oracle 的核心工具来跟踪、监控、诊断性能; ? 高效的数据库逻辑与物理设计、索引设计、事务设计以及 API 的使用; SQL 与 PL/SQL 调优,包含并行 SQL 技术的使用; ? 小化排队锁、闩锁、共
本书以oracle 10g为基础,主要介绍oracle数据库的安装与卸载、体系结构、管理数据库、管理数据、存储管理、对象管理、oracle安全管理、备份和恢复以及pl/sql语言基础。 本书注重实用性和技能的结合,选材贴近实际,图文并茂,力求浅显易懂。每章均配有思考与练习及上机实验,加深读者对所学知识的理解。 本书可作为大专院校数据库等相关专业的教学用书或参考用书,还可作为广大数据库技术爱好者的自学用书。
这本《OCA认证考试指南(1Z0-047 Oracle DatabaseSQL Expert)》由 Steve O'Hearn著,颜炯、齐宁译。本书的目的是为参加OCA SQL CertifiedExpeitExam(120—047)考试的读者提供帮助。每一章都提供了练习题、实践题、知识要点总结,使读者能够充分理解和掌握每一章所学内容。《OCA认证考试指南(1Z0-047Oracle Database SQLExpert)》是OCA认证考试1.Z0—047权威的辅导教程,也是Oracle从业人员的参考书之一。
Oracle是目前全球应用广泛、功能强大的关系型数据库。本书结合大量实例,详细地讲述了Oracle数据库各方面的知识。全书内容包括Oracle安装配置、Oracle常用开发工具、SQL Plus、数据表、视图、约束、函数与存储过程、触发器、序列、索引、用户与角色、内置函数、控制语句、SQL查询及更新语句、并发与锁定、正则表达式、与编程语言结合使用。为了便于读者学习与把握,在每章都使用了单独的小节来展示实例,并给出习题和答案。 本书光盘附带书中所涉及的源文件和数据库脚本。同时,光盘还附带配套全程视频,以便于读者更好地掌握本书内容。 本书适合Oracle数据库开发人员、基于Oracle数据库的软件程序员、Oracle数据库管理员、大专院校学生,以及对Oracle开发有兴趣的人员。本书浅显易懂、实例丰富,尤其适合广大程序员自学。
《大话Oracle RAC:集群 高可用性 备份与恢复》以Oracle 10g为基础,对OracleRAC进行了全面的介绍和分析。全书分为两个部分,共14章,第1部分是集群理论篇,这部分从集群基础知识入手,通过分析集群环境和单机环境的不同,介绍了集群环境的各个组件及其作用,以及集群环境的一些专有技术,包括OracleClusterware、Oracle Database、ASM、CacheFusion等。第2部分是实践篇,每一章都针对RAC的一个知识点展开讲解,包括OracleClusterware的维护、HA与LB、备份、恢复、Flashback家族、RAC和DataGuard的结合使用、RAC和Stream的结合使用,后对ASM进行深入介绍,并给出性能调整的指导思想。 《大话Oracle RAC:集群高可用性备份与恢复》按照“发现问题→解决问题→实践与理论相结合”的方式进行介绍,首先对现实问题进行分析,然后提供合适的解决方案,后自然地引出Oracle中的理论知识点,
本书旨在为初学者提供一本入门级书籍。使得读者可按本书中的内容,从零开始,独立完成数据库的基本安装配置、SQL书写、数据库管理、备份恢复,并了解初步的性能优化的相关知识。本书摒弃了以往相关书籍以理论为主的写作理念,重在引导读者实际动手完成操作。
Oracle是目前主流的数据库平台之一,与IBM的DB2,Microsoft的SQL Server占领了绝大部分的市场,是大型数据库系统的*产品。其性能卓越,久经考验。本书以实例为依托,从易向难,展示如何开发Oracle应用程序,并根据目前实际中的企业应用,来构建我们的程序框架。 通过本书的学习,读者可以快速了解如何在Oracle下开发简单的应用,以及企业应用程序等。更重要的是,读者要领会一种程序结构的思想,即如何在实践中把多层应用到实际的项目中,实现各个层次的良好分离,方便开发及维护。 本书是在校大学生学习使用Oracle进行课程设计的好帮手和重要参考资料,是在校学生 了解企业开发的一个好窗口,也是研究生撰写毕业论文时好的参考文献。同时它还可供Oracle应用程序的开发人员,以及对相关技术感兴趣的读者参考使用。另外,在本书实例中,尽量使用Oracle开
这是国内本深度讲解如何架构与设计高并发Oracle数据库系统的著作,也是国内本系统讲解内存数据库TimesTen的专著。作者是拥有10余年Oracle从业经验的资深数据库架构师,本书的内容也得到了业界以盖国强为代表的数位数据库专家的一致认可。本书秉承大道至简的思想,技术与艺术并重,从技术、方法论、原理和思想等角度讲解了如何架构与设计高并发Oracle数据库系统。 全书主要内容从三个维度展开:首先是内部扩展的维度,深入探讨了高效B树索引、高效表设计、查询优化器等数据库架构设计与优化的核心技术,以及高并发Oracle数据库系统架构与设计的方法论和常见的高并发案例;其次是纵向扩展的维度,国内首次详细讲解了内存数据库TimesTen的基本使用、高可用架构设计、缓存应用、监控方法、数据备份与恢复、数据迁移以及高并发场景;后是横向扩展
本书涉及了Oracle优化的所有方面,系统地讲述了Oracle优化的相关内容。本书分为5个部分。第1部分总体介绍了性能计划、实例优化和SQL优化,也简单提及了优化过程中会用到的一些特性和工具。第2部分描述了在一般情况下和紧急情况下的性能优化的通用方法。第3部分对在性能计划阶段应该考虑的性能优化相关的事项进行了介绍。第4部分介绍了如何通过优化实例来提升数据库性能。第5部分介绍了如何对SQL进行优化,SQL的优化重点在于对执行计划的优化。 本书可以帮你叩开Oracle优化的大门,让你直接看到想要的正确的、完整的答案。如果你想学习Oracle优化,想要成为这方面的专家,那么本书将帮助你实现这个目标。
本书关注于如何通过*发布的oracle weblogic server 11g进行javaee开发、部署和管理。与其他介绍weblogic server和javaee技术的书籍不同,本书的内容较为深刻,针对的是中高级读者。而且,本书描述的是思路。不只是简单地罗列出解决问题的各种可选方案,而后教会读者自己去做决策,还提供了在应用程序开发和管理过程中能够使用的具体建议和*实践。本书构建并讲解的主要示例应用程序是一个真实复杂的应用程序,涵盖了很多javaee技术的许多特征,以及oracle weblogic server 119特有的技术。 本书并不是java ee技术和weblogicserver环境的入门读物。这是一本高水平的书,对基本概念的描述很少,因此本书面向的读者是有经验的开发人员和weblogicserver管理员,通过阅读本书他们可以将自己对这些技术的认识提升到更高水平。
赵宇兰编著的《Oracle数据库应用技术》从Oracle数据库应用环境入手,对Oracle的运作原理与体系结构,网络联机架构与设定,高可91数据库的详细创建和配置,表、索引、完整性约束、同义词、序列等数据库对象和延伸应用的高可91性对象的应91,以及数据库后台编程技术等内容进行了深入讲解。本书既详细介绍了0racle数据库表面的行为特征,又借助大量示例剖析了相关技术原理,阐述了理论知识在实践中的应用3-法。本书结构科学,示例丰富,实用性强,有利于指导读者实践。 《Oracle数据库应用技术》可供Oracle数据库从业人员使用,也可作为高等院校计算机相关专业课的教学参考资料。
《华章程序员书库:Oracle性能预测》是Oracle性能预测领域的著作,Amazon全五星评价,资深Oracle数据库专家近20年工作经验结晶。系统讲解了Oracle性能预测的方法、模型、技术、步骤、技巧,而且总结了大量*实践,几乎可以满足日常工作中可能遇到的各种预测需求。 《华章程序员书库:Oracle性能预测》共10章。第1章介绍了性能预测的基本概念和范畴,分析了预测提供的信息及其价值;第2章介绍了基本的性能预测概念,深入研究了如何组合及建模性能预测;第3章介绍了提高预测精度的一些有效手段,通过选择合适的预测模型,选择合适的工作负载活动来提高预测精度;第4章介绍了基本预测统计的概念,并简单介绍了统计在性能预测方面的应用;第5章涵盖了预测非常重要的一个组成部分——排队论;第6章介绍了系统化地进行性能预测的6个步骤;第7章通过说
本书为应用开发人员提供了使用Pro*C/C++开发数据库应用的方法。针对各种不同类型的Pro*C/C++应用,本书都提供了非常详细、具体的开发方法,并且为读者提供了大量的示例程序。本书不仅介绍了各种类型Pro*C/C++应用的开发方法,而且还介绍了Oracle 11g在Pro*C/C++方面所提供的各种新特征,包括使用大纲固定执行计划、DB2数组插入和数组提取、隐含缓冲区插入、动态SQL语句缓存等。通过学习本书,读者可以快速掌握使用Pro*C/C++开发数据库应用的方法。
本书通过实际的实验、示例和项目来讲解你所需的全部PL/SQL技能,它涵盖从基础语法、程序控制到*的优化和安全增强等方面的知识。读者循序渐进地学习每个关键任务,自己就能掌握当今有价值的Oracle12c的PL/SQL编程技术。本书的方法完全反映了作者在哥伦比亚大学给专业人员讲授PL/SQL的广受好评的经验。数据库开发的新手和DBA可以通过学习本书快速获得成效。有经验的PL/SQL程序员会发现本书是很好的Oracle12c的解决方案参考。